What local unis can learn about rape culture from the Brock Turner case

The internet has exploded with reactions, ranging from vitriolic to darkly comedic, in the wake of Stanford University's Brock Turner being sentenced to only six months in jail – of which he'll probably serve only three – for penetrating an unconscious female student behind a dumpster near a party they had both attended.
